Blood Product
Any therapeutic substance prepared from human blood, including whole blood, plasma, and cellular components.
Vital Signs
Key measurements of the body's basic functioning, including temperature, heart rate, respiration rate, and blood pressure.
Pulse Oximetry
A non-invasive method to measure the oxygen saturation level of the blood, providing insights into a person's respiratory efficiency.
Respiratory Arrest
A critical condition in which breathing completely stops, requiring immediate medical intervention to restore breathing and oxygenation.
